Electron是一个使用JavaScript、HTML和CSS构建桌面应用程序的开源框架。它基于Chromium和Node.js,可以使用Web技术进行跨平台的桌面应用程序开发。使用Electron进行桌面软件前端开发,开发者可以使用熟悉的Web前端技术进行开发,在开发效率和用户体验上都有很大的优势。开发者可以使用HTML和CSS创建出精美的用户界面,使用JavaScrip...
通过将这两者结合起来,我们可以在Electron应用程序中使用C语言编写高性能和底层的模块,从而提升应用程序的性能和功能。 接下来,我们将介绍如何在Electron中调用C代码。首先,我们需要使用Node.js的插件机制来实现这一功能。Node.js允许我们编写C/C++扩展,然后通过JavaScript代码将其加载到Electron应用程序中。通过这种方式,...
Main Process(主进程)。是 Node.js 跑的一个进程,可以调用 Node API 和 Electron 封装好的 API。 Renderer Process(渲染进程)。是运行在 Chromium 中的 web 进程。 因为Electron 出于安全考虑,渲染进程的 API 是有限制的。因为 web 端可能会加载第三方 js 代码,不可能让第三方为所欲为的。 假如在一些场景中...
51CTO博客已为您找到关于electron c#桌面开发的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及electron c#桌面开发问答内容。更多electron c#桌面开发相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
1、vue-cli-plugin-electron-builder插件方式 1.全局安装vue-cli: npm install -g @vue/cli 2.创建vue项目(注意这里选择vue2或者vue3都可以,我选择vue3): vue create my-electron 3.创建项目后进入项目安装插件(注意不是npm): cd my-electron ...
electron是一个客户端的开发框架你开发的应用需要服务端的支持而服务端的事情electron是不参与的 有没有办法集成到一起,我点击EXE 服务端和用户端都跑起来了那么服务端和客户端不都跑在一起了么,那你要服务端干什么呢? 有用 回复 继欧巴: 恩,服务端和用户端是分开的,我的需求是一个脚本吧服务端和客户端都...
不知道大家在开发 electron 应用时,是否遇到过这样的需求:目前,公司有两个桌面应用,希望在启动一个...
搞electron真的需要个顶配电脑 | 最近在对接业务方,业务方的技术选型方案是用electron框架,把electron源码又完整的下下来编译了一遍。 这次不得不夸一下手上刚换的Mac,M2 Pro/64G/2T,性能真的强,不过最好再单独拉一根带宽500M以上的有线,gclient sync 真的很耗时。
A simple app that demonstrates the use of Electron as Front-End and C ++ DLLs as Back-End. Clone and run for a quick way to see Electron in action. This is a minimal Electron application based on the Quick Start Guide within the Electron documentation. Use this app along with the Elect...
constpath=require('path');require('@millyc/electron-reload')(__dirname,{electron:path.join(__dirname,'node_modules','.bin','electron'),hardResetMethod:'exit',}); API electronReload(paths, options) paths: a file, directory or glob pattern to watch ...